Technical Details of Quantum LTO Ultrium-7 M8 Data Cartridge

  • Format: LTO Ultrium-8 Type M (LTO-7 M8) tape cartridge
  • Native capacity: 9 TB per cartridge
  • Pack size: 20 cartridges per pack
  • Labeling: Labeled for easy content identification
  • Recommended use: Backups, disaster recovery, active archive, compliance, data preservation, scale-out NAS, and cloud storage workflows

How to install Quantum LTO Ultrium-7 M8 Data Cartridge

  • Verify compatibility: Confirm that your tape drive or library supports LTO-8 Type M (LTO-7 M8) media and that firmware is up to date to ensure optimal recognition and performance.
  • Prepare the environment: Store cartridges in a cool, dry, and clean environment away from magnetic sources. Handle media by the edges, avoiding contact with the tape surface to prevent degradation.
  • Power down and access the drive/library: If installing into a library, ensure the system is powered down or follow your library’s hot-swap procedures. Open the drive or slot cover as required by your hardware.
  • Insert the cartridge: Carefully insert the LTO Ultrium-7 M8 cartridge into an available drive bay or slot. Gently push until the cartridge seats and is detected by the drive, then close the bay or cover securely.
  • Verify recognition: Power up (if necessary) and perform a media inventory or drive scan to confirm the cartridge is recognized, traceable by barcode/label, and ready for operation.
  • Run a test operation: Execute a small backup or verification job to confirm data integrity and successful read/write operations before moving to production workloads.
  • Document and store: Record the cartridge’s content, date of insertion, and retention policy. Return the cartridge to its designated slot or media cabinet to maintain organized, retrievable storage.
